Join our world-class team today!Position Specific DescriptionPlant Martin.Job OverviewThe duties of this classification include all of the functions of the Utilityworker classification plus higher skill level activities such as painting, building maintenance, asbestos abatement, scaffold building, equipment demolition, insulation work,and carpentry. Training will be provided by the company for any special skills required to perform the assigned tasks. This classification works under the direction of the Maintenance Leader or crew leader, however they may take direction from a journey level employee. This classification may work as a Utilityworker to assist a journey level employee working on production equipment. This individual will be required to travel to other locations as workload requires.Minimum requirements for job: None.Accountabilities:1) Painting, building maintenance, asbestos abatement, scaffold building, equipment demolition, insulation work and carpentry.2) Operates power and hand tools and other equipment necessary to provide a safe, clean and productive work place.3) Functions in support of other classifications and their respective accountabilities.4) Performs associated responsibilities according to the safe work practices handbook and the Memorandum of Agreement.Required QualificationsPwr Plt Mtce Pos Sel Sys Test passed
